Going through some junk a while back I came across some old 3x5 floppy discs. Tossed one, tossed two, tossed three into the trash...four into the trash...hey wait, I can do something with these things..
I snapped off the thin metal shield and made a shim to open a cheap lock I had on my desk. Sure you can buy a shim set and keep it in your wallet or "kit"...but if you know the principal behind it, you'll have more shims than you'll know what to do with. And what if you've been seperated from your "gear" for whatever reason? Keep an eye out for crap like this laying around. You can open a lock and since you didn't take a sledge to it, you can put it right back in place when you're done.
I'll admit if you're in a bind and need to shim a lock, you might not have a pair of scissors on you, and I chould have done this the hard way, but I thought of that later on. I actually didn't even use the SOG there on the desk. You could use the edge of a table or any other right angle to bend and break most thin metal..
